What are you supposed to use on them? If I want to do these myself and not rely on a stylist, what am I going to need? (besides patience)


When my locks were longer, I used to use Khamit Kinks hair oil on wetter than damp but not sopping hair. I never used clips and my hair held.

I sometimes used oil mixed with a medium hold clear (not black) gel. Or TW Lock It Up.

Well, is it possible to start dreads on long black hair?

Or do you have to cut down and start wiht those twisty coils on short hair?

You can start locs at any length you choose..I have sisterlocs and I started them on natrual hair that was close to BSL.

oh and btw locs have shrinkage too...but afterwhile the locs condense and drop into place
